Whoa! I keep hearing people say a wallet is just a keyring these days. That line always makes me bristle. Here’s the thing: a modern wallet does far more than store keys. When you trade across Ethereum, Arbitrum, Solana, and a half-dozen EVM-compatible chains, your wallet is your last line of defense and the first line of offense if it can simulate and pre-check transactions before they leave your device. Okay, so check this out—wallet features now change outcomes. Medium tech details matter. Simulating transactions locally, bundling to avoid MEV, and giving you clear approval controls can save users real money. On one hand a sloppy wallet leaks approvals and exposes users to front-running and sandwich attacks; on the other hand a smarter wallet can show you exactly what a contract call will do, detect suspicious slippage, and even suggest alternative routes that cost less gas or bypass risky contracts. Honestly, my instinct said early on that UX would win. It did, partly. Initially I thought flashy UIs would be the main factor, but then I realized that the underlying capabilities — simulation, RPC selection, and per-call isolation — are where real security lives. Something felt off about handing power to wallets that couldn’t simulate transactions in a forked environment, because simulation is how you catch those weird approve/spend combos that look benign but chain-scan as traps. Seriously? Yes. Tools like tx simulation are the difference between a close call and a disaster. Medium folks in DeFi are the most likely to say “I got this”, and then a token approval drains funds because they missed a nested call. The more advanced wallets will show you allowances, nested contract behavior, and any token hooks that could mint or transfer funds elsewhere—before you sign, not after. Here’s a small story. I bridged a small amount between L2s last year and felt uneasy. My gut told me somethin’ wasn’t right with the bridge interface. I paused. I used a different wallet to simulate the transaction and it highlighted an unusually high allowance that would have given a router contract permission to move funds beyond the single swap. Saved me a headache. Not dramatic, but very real. Practical features to prioritize in a modern multi-chain wallet If you want to avoid the classic traps, prioritize simulation-first wallets that also give you granular approval control and MEV-aware routing. I recommend wallets that simulate a transaction on a forked state (so the simulation mirrors current mempool and contract state), show exact token approvals that will be changed, and let you set approval caps or use one-time permits. For me, having a wallet that makes these things obvious is non-negotiable, and that’s why I use rabby wallet for most day-to-day DeFi work. Short sentence. Medium detail now. The mechanics are straightforward: simulation recreates the exact contract interactions, including any internal calls that would otherwise be invisible. Longer thought: when a wallet simulates on a forked state close to real-time and combines that with gas estimation and mempool analysis, it can predict sandwich risk, detect reentrancy-like flows in complex swaps, and then propose bundling strategies or alternative DEX routes to mitigate slippage and MEV exposure. I’m biased, but readability matters, too. Wallets that bury approvals in tiny dialogs are irresponsible. A helpful wallet will flag high-risk approvals, explain consequences in plain English, and offer safer defaults. Also, having chain-agnostic portfolio tracking built-in means you can see exposure across dozens of networks without juggling CSVs or thirty tabs. Hmm… one more nuance. RPC choice is underrated. Using unreliable or censored RPCs can amplify risk during congestion or MEV events. Good wallets let you switch RPCs, use redundancy, or even route through privacy-preserving nodes. That flexibility gives you better simulation fidelity and faster, more predictable submits when timing matters. On MEV specifically: it’s complicated and a little ugly. On one hand MEV is profit for searchers. On the other hand, unprotected users get sandwich attacks and front-runs. Some wallets attempt to bundle transactions or integrate with relays to submit transactions in ways that minimize extractable value. Others bake in reorder-resilient tactics. Neither approach is perfect, but User-facing MEV protections reduce ordinary users’ likelihood of getting reamed on a bad swap. Initially I thought MEV protection was only for whales. Actually, wait—let me rephrase that. It matters for anyone doing swaps or interacting with liquidity pools. Medium trades get eaten too. When network congestion spikes, you either overpay for priority or you lose to searchers. A wallet that simulates and suggests a safe gas strategy (or uses private relays) will save you money over time, very very important. Bridges deserve a paragraph. They are dangerous. The smart ones will simulate the entire flow and show checkpoints: lock, mint, and any cross-chain verifier behavior. Some bridges also provide fraud proofs or time-locks that a wallet can surface. If a wallet can’t explain what part of the flow is trust-minimized, I treat that as a red flag. (Oh, and by the way…) always treat newly deployed bridge contracts with skepticism. Now, on portfolio tracking: I like wallets that give you aggregated cost basis and realize/unrealized P&L across chains. Short wins. Medium wins happen when the wallet also alerts you to token rug indicators or unusual tokenomics (like sudden mints). Longer thought: if your wallet integrates on-chain analytics to flag tokens that have huge centralized liquidity or odd owner powers, you can avoid holding bags that flip to zero overnight. Device security still matters. Seed phrases are fragile. Use hardware wallets for large balances. Use software wallets for quick interactions, but pair them with strong simulation and spend-control features. I’m not 100% sure which single workflow fits everyone, but a common pattern I follow is: keep long-term holdings on a hardware-secured vault and use a simulation-first software wallet for active trading. Here’s what bugs me about the current wallet landscape: many apps look slick but are feature-poor under the hood. They gloss over approvals, offer weak RPCs, and give no MEV awareness. Users see good-looking charts and feel safe, though actually their funds are wide open to predictable attacks. There’s a cognitive bias here—pretty UI confers perceived safety even when the plumbing is weak. On the flip side, some technical wallets are clunky but powerful. My compromise is a wallet that blends both: clear UX, strong simulations, and advanced options tucked behind an expert mode. That way both newbies and power users get value, and the wallet can grow with you as your strategies evolve. Also, it’s nice when wallets integrate portfolio exports and tax-friendly reports without forcing you into a maze of CSV conversion tools. Longer reflection now: as DeFi matures, the boundary between a wallet and a risk-management dashboard will blur. We’ll see wallets that auto-suggest safer routes, batch transactions into atomic bundles, and let users opt into private relays without needing to be crypto-native. That shift changes how people interact with protocols and reduces accidental losses from innocent mistakes. One caveat: no wallet is a magic bullet. Even the most feature-rich app can’t protect you from social engineering, phishing sites, or compromised endpoints. Your habits still matter. Always verify contract addresses, use connect-with-care flow, and confirm details in hardware when possible. I’m biased toward doing small test transactions on new platforms. It slows you down but it also saves both time and money in the long run. FAQ How does transaction simulation actually stop scams? Simulation reproduces the contract calls that would run on-chain and shows you the net effects—token movements, approvals, and nested calls. That visibility lets you identify unexpected transfers or minting actions before signing, which is how you avoid many rug pulls or draining approvals. Is MEV protection worth the tradeoffs? Short answer: usually yes for active traders. MEV protection can add latency or fees but often reduces the worst-case losses from sandwiching and front-running. If you trade small, the benefit may be marginal, but as trades scale the protections matter more. Can a single wallet handle many chains safely? Yes, but only if it offers good RPC options, tight approval controls, accurate simulation across chains, and clear portfolio aggregation. Some wallets do this well, blending user-friendly interfaces with expert-level protections.